What is the prime factorization of 169?

The 3 factors of 169 are 1, 13, and 169. The factor pairs of 169 are 1 x 169 and 13 x 13.The prime factors of 169 are 13 and 13.The prime factorization of 169 is 13 x 13 or, in exponential form, 132.Factor Tree:One way to determine the prime factors is to construct a factor tree, continuing to factor each level until all the numbers have been factored into prime numbers. 16913 x 13Since 13 is a prime number, the factor tree is complete.13 x 13

Is 169 a prime?

A prime number is a number that is divisible only by 1 and itself; it has no other factors. The factors of 169 are 1, 13, and 169. Therefore, 169 is not a prime number. It is a composite number.


What makes a factorization of a number a prime factorization?

When all the factors are prime numbers, that's a prime factorization.
